Ingredients

Instructions

  • Roll each ball into 8"-long rope. Tie rope into a loose knot with one end in each hand. Continue knotting until the ends meet. Squeeze the loose ends together; press joined ends down so they will be hidden on bottom of roll.
  • Place rolls in greased 9" x 13" baking pan about 2" apart and cover with plastic wrap or lint free towel. Place in warm area until doubled in size (1−1½ hours).
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ees and bake rolls 10−12 minutes until golden brown.
  • Melt butter in a small microwavable bowl while rolls are baking. Add garlic powder and parsley; set aside.
  • When rolls are done, immediately brush with melted garlic butter and sprinkle with Parmesan. Enjoy!
